Cut-over of the Harrowbine farm-equipment telemetry gateway completed 02:10. All tractor and irrigation units now report through the new ingest path; old endpoint is dark. Backlog drained in 40 min, no dropped frames. Known issue: two combine units in the Dell Prairie fleet reconnect slowly after power cycles — harmless, retries succeed. If ingest stalls, restart the collector pods, nothing else. Do not modify settings without paging Ines first. The gateway's live configuration values are listed below.

config for hahaf-kafof:
[wenys]
host = wenys.torvahq.corp
user = wenys_svc
database = wenys_prod

## Deploying the Gatewick Proctor Queue

Deploys are pretty painless: push to main, wait for the pipeline, then watch the queue drain dashboard for five minutes. If candidates pile up mid-exam, roll back first and ask questions later — the queue replays safely. Everything the workers care about lives in one config block, shown here for reference.

settings of bafof-yagef:
JOROX_PIN=8740
JOROX_TENANT=pelox
JOROX_METRICS_HOST=metrics.jorox.qorvelworks.internal
JOROX_SEAL=seal_c78f63c1
JOROX_STANDBY_TEAM=norax

Subject: Handover — template rendering perf release

Hi, taking over from me tonight for the Quillfire 2.9 rollout. The new precompiled template cache cuts render time roughly 40%, but watch memory on the Dunmore pool for the first hour; roll back if RSS climbs past the alert line. Verify the release bundle with the key below.

release key, fajef-kajeg: bky19_LdLu6Ne6FLi8he2c24d

## Runbook: Tariffwheel Rules Engine

Tariffwheel evaluates shipping-fee rules for the Mossgate checkout service. Rules are loaded read-only from a signed bundle at boot; no runtime mutation is permitted. The engine runs in its own sandboxed process with network egress disabled except to the audit sink. For this review, the relevant hardening options are captured in the configuration below.

config for yajep-tafof:
[rusath]
team = julmir
access_code = ac_fe37fd
host = rusath.novactech.test
port = 8000
owner = pelmir.weneth
peer = oliwyn.olvarqdyn.internal